C#中没有直接的实现,需要自己编写或使用第三方库,比如FuzzySharp。
下面是一个完整的示例,展示如何使用Golang发送HTTP请求、设置自定义头部、传递参数以及解析响应内容。
项目级Go版本控制 现代Go项目通常在根目录使用 go.mod 文件声明最低支持版本: module example.com/myproject go 1.21 这不强制使用特定安装版本,但提示开发者应使用Go 1.21及以上。
同时维护多个主版本 如果你想在同一仓库中维护 v1 和 v2 两个主版本,可以采用以下结构: 根目录 (v2): go.mod 中声明 module example.com/mypkg/v2 分支方式:用 v1 分支保留旧版本代码,主分支开发 v2 或使用多版本目录(较少见):将 v1 放在 /v1 目录,v2 在根目录或 /v2 通常推荐使用分支策略来维护老版本,主分支推进新版本。
默认值选择: 仔细考虑并选择合理的默认值。
这样,你就避免了对不相关文件进行字符串匹配的开销。
数据获取: 利用 yfinance、tushare 等库获取历史股票数据。
以下是常见的错误排查步骤,帮助你快速定位并解决问题。
右值引用的核心价值在于减少冗余拷贝,提高资源管理效率,尤其是在标准库容器(如 vector、string)中广泛应用。
根据使用场景选择合适的定义方式即可。
使用 Laravel 的内置身份验证系统来构建安全可靠的应用程序。
更安全的文件操作: 在生产环境中,使用 copy + unlink 替换 rename 可以提供更强的错误恢复能力,特别是在跨文件系统的情况下。
var p *int 表示 p 是一个指向整型的指针 p = &x 表示将变量 x 的地址赋给 p *p 表示访问 p 所指向的值 指针是显式的,你可以自由传递地址、解引用,也可以为 nil。
错误示例: std::function<void()> dangerous_lambda; { int temp = 42; dangerous_lambda = [&temp]() { std::cout << temp << std::endl; }; } // temp 已销毁 dangerous_lambda(); // 未定义行为!
智能指针会在不再需要对象时自动释放内存。
dd() 函数(dump and die)会立即停止脚本执行并打印出变量的详细内容,这对于调试异常对象非常有用。
AI改写智能降低AIGC率和重复率。
2. JavaScript 函数 downloadForce 这个函数负责处理文件的异步获取和下载逻辑。
在实际开发中,需要根据具体的需求进行调整和优化。
只要编译时加入调试信息,就可以通过GDB逐步执行代码、查看变量值、设置断点等操作来定位错误。
本文链接:http://www.asphillseesit.com/284213_122a00.html